Transaction 3c33a193d073e28d25f1b2bb8fc458b8ed48dddf3718b1559474ae78b6311384

1 Input
2 Outputs
  • 3c33a193d073e28d25f1b2bb8fc458b8ed48dddf3718b1559474ae78b6311384:0
  • value  3883184900
    address  1HKMkDgKk4CTZGL1KnmUuQxg43FVXxf5sg
  • 3c33a193d073e28d25f1b2bb8fc458b8ed48dddf3718b1559474ae78b6311384:1
  • value  133612845
    address  1HZPbE6kSUjk9AbbLP8ui4zR9xqGZ1LTZ6